Transaction ab21126e7ccb084444c92e69562030971144698ecf965f7ae551c555f7da00da
1 Input
2 Outputs
- ab21126e7ccb084444c92e69562030971144698ecf965f7ae551c555f7da00da:0
- ab21126e7ccb084444c92e69562030971144698ecf965f7ae551c555f7da00da:1
value 24562
address 3B51cYYpGzQNyknw3mSAstL5DQEbb1gN5q
value 65738
address 1GhtqtEP4UYJH4Fv4V762YSxbZy92CjqkX